flux reports: tamed mobs should be protected ... #2189

Open
opened 2022-07-09 01:50:57 +00:00 by yourland-report · 3 comments

flux reports a bug:

tamed mobs should be protected by default. both petz and mobs_animals

Player position:

{
	y = 48,
	x = 1274.7590332031,
	z = 592.25695800781
}

Player look:

{
	y = -0.4438533782959,
	x = -0.029397632926702,
	z = -0.89561706781387
}

Player information:

{
	min_rtt = 0.15099999308586,
	max_rtt = 7.7969999313354,
	connection_uptime = 171674,
	max_jitter = 7.6360001564026,
	minor = 6,
	major = 5,
	ip_version = 6,
	formspec_version = 5,
	patch = 0,
	protocol_version = 40,
	serialization_version = 29,
	lang_code = "",
	version_string = "5.6.0-dev-874bb40be-dirty",
	avg_rtt = 0.16099999845028,
	state = "Active",
	avg_jitter = 0,
	min_jitter = 0
}

Player meta:

{
	fields = {
		["3d_armor_inventory"] = "return {\"3d_armor:chestplate_nether 1 10520\", \"nether_mobs:dragon_shield 1 5260\", \"3d_armor:helmet_nether 1 5260\", \"nether_mobs:dragon_boots 1 5260\", \"3d_armor:leggings_nether 1 10520\", \"\"}",
		["petz:werewolf_vignette_id"] = "20",
		played_time = "19284321",
		jointime = "1615351173",
		yl_commons_player_joined = "1657159804",
		["stamina:exhaustion"] = "116",
		["signslib:pos"] = "(1290,63,550)",
		digged_nodes = "1067543",
		yl_commons_thankyou = "126",
		died = "66",
		bitten = "0",
		["unified_inventory:bags"] = "return {\"water_life:croc_bag\", \"water_life:croc_bag\", \"water_life:croc_bag\", \"water_life:croc_bag\"}",
		partychat = "party",
		["petz:werewolf"] = "0",
		["petz:lycanthropy"] = "1",
		yl_church = "return {[\"last_death\"] = {[\"y\"] = 48, [\"x\"] = 1289, [\"z\"] = 624}, [\"last_heal\"] = 1615504208, [\"last_death_portal\"] = 1653796347}",
		punch_count = "79949",
		["stamina:level"] = "5",
		xp = "1242057",
		arenalib_infobox_arenaID = "0",
		inflicted_damage = "1291308",
		crafted = "38501",
		["petz:old_override_table"] = "return {[\"new_move\"] = true, [\"sneak\"] = true, [\"sneak_glitch\"] = false, [\"jump\"] = 1.5, [\"speed\"] = 2, [\"gravity\"] = 1}",
		["stamina:poisoned"] = "no",
		["petz:werewolf_clan_idx"] = "1",
		placed_nodes = "347348",
		hud_state = "on",
		repellant = "0",
		yl_commons_player_created = "1615351173"
	}
}

Log identifier


[MOD] yl_report log identifier = NZ5wio3qgfebeL9jpN8iyOk58zuH5Wam

Profiler save:

profile-20220709T035056.json_prettyEE

Status:

# Server: version: 5.5.1-yl | game: Minetest Game | uptime: 3d 16h 2min 23s | max lag: 3.04s | clients: MineB, denki_kami_thecat, AliasAlreadyTaken, Sokomine, AspireMint, jackofthebean000, Service, Bailiff, digdeep, Hulda, LeetPeet, GrimPixel, pitman, flux

Teleport command:

/teleport xyz 1275 48 592

Compass command:

/give_compass Construction NZ5wio3qgfebeL9jpN8iyOk58zuH5Wam D2691E 1275 48 592
flux reports a bug: > tamed mobs should be protected by default. both petz and mobs_animals Player position: ``` { y = 48, x = 1274.7590332031, z = 592.25695800781 } ``` Player look: ``` { y = -0.4438533782959, x = -0.029397632926702, z = -0.89561706781387 } ``` Player information: ``` { min_rtt = 0.15099999308586, max_rtt = 7.7969999313354, connection_uptime = 171674, max_jitter = 7.6360001564026, minor = 6, major = 5, ip_version = 6, formspec_version = 5, patch = 0, protocol_version = 40, serialization_version = 29, lang_code = "", version_string = "5.6.0-dev-874bb40be-dirty", avg_rtt = 0.16099999845028, state = "Active", avg_jitter = 0, min_jitter = 0 } ``` Player meta: ``` { fields = { ["3d_armor_inventory"] = "return {\"3d_armor:chestplate_nether 1 10520\", \"nether_mobs:dragon_shield 1 5260\", \"3d_armor:helmet_nether 1 5260\", \"nether_mobs:dragon_boots 1 5260\", \"3d_armor:leggings_nether 1 10520\", \"\"}", ["petz:werewolf_vignette_id"] = "20", played_time = "19284321", jointime = "1615351173", yl_commons_player_joined = "1657159804", ["stamina:exhaustion"] = "116", ["signslib:pos"] = "(1290,63,550)", digged_nodes = "1067543", yl_commons_thankyou = "126", died = "66", bitten = "0", ["unified_inventory:bags"] = "return {\"water_life:croc_bag\", \"water_life:croc_bag\", \"water_life:croc_bag\", \"water_life:croc_bag\"}", partychat = "party", ["petz:werewolf"] = "0", ["petz:lycanthropy"] = "1", yl_church = "return {[\"last_death\"] = {[\"y\"] = 48, [\"x\"] = 1289, [\"z\"] = 624}, [\"last_heal\"] = 1615504208, [\"last_death_portal\"] = 1653796347}", punch_count = "79949", ["stamina:level"] = "5", xp = "1242057", arenalib_infobox_arenaID = "0", inflicted_damage = "1291308", crafted = "38501", ["petz:old_override_table"] = "return {[\"new_move\"] = true, [\"sneak\"] = true, [\"sneak_glitch\"] = false, [\"jump\"] = 1.5, [\"speed\"] = 2, [\"gravity\"] = 1}", ["stamina:poisoned"] = "no", ["petz:werewolf_clan_idx"] = "1", placed_nodes = "347348", hud_state = "on", repellant = "0", yl_commons_player_created = "1615351173" } } ``` Log identifier ``` [MOD] yl_report log identifier = NZ5wio3qgfebeL9jpN8iyOk58zuH5Wam ``` Profiler save: ``` profile-20220709T035056.json_prettyEE ``` Status: ``` # Server: version: 5.5.1-yl | game: Minetest Game | uptime: 3d 16h 2min 23s | max lag: 3.04s | clients: MineB, denki_kami_thecat, AliasAlreadyTaken, Sokomine, AspireMint, jackofthebean000, Service, Bailiff, digdeep, Hulda, LeetPeet, GrimPixel, pitman, flux ``` Teleport command: ``` /teleport xyz 1275 48 592 ``` Compass command: ``` /give_compass Construction NZ5wio3qgfebeL9jpN8iyOk58zuH5Wam D2691E 1275 48 592 ```
AliasAlreadyTaken was assigned by yourland-report 2022-07-09 01:50:57 +00:00
flux added the
1. kind/enhancement
4. step/want approval
2. prio/interesting
labels 2022-07-09 02:27:43 +00:00
flux added this to the flux's TODO list project 2022-07-09 02:27:48 +00:00

What's the reasoning behind this?

Not in favour. This would invalidate dreamcatcher and protection rune mechanics. It would also take the decision off people which to keep: They'd simply keep them all.

your-land/administration#144

What's the reasoning behind this? Not in favour. This would invalidate dreamcatcher and protection rune mechanics. It would also take the decision off people which to keep: They'd simply keep them all. https://gitea.your-land.de/your-land/administration/issues/144
AliasAlreadyTaken added the
4. step/question
label 2022-08-07 07:47:49 +00:00
Member

often times, players aren't aware of the mob protection mechanics, and throw a fit when their animals are killed by other players. i want to allow players to make farms and zoos and have pets without worrying about all the ways the animals might die.

often times, players aren't aware of the mob protection mechanics, and throw a fit when their animals are killed by other players. i want to allow players to make farms and zoos and have pets without worrying about all the ways the animals might die.
flux added
4. step/at work
and removed
4. step/question
4. step/want approval
labels 2022-10-30 18:20:31 +00:00
AliasAlreadyTaken was unassigned by flux 2022-10-30 18:20:38 +00:00
flux self-assigned this 2022-10-30 18:20:39 +00:00
Member

in the new mob api, protect-on-tame will probaly be a config option, and protection items will still be able to exist

in the new mob api, protect-on-tame will probaly be a config option, and protection items will still be able to exist
flux added the
2. prio/controversial
label 2022-11-09 17:57:57 +00:00
flux removed the
4. step/at work
label 2023-02-27 21:16:54 +00:00
Sign in to join this conversation.
No Milestone
No Assignees
3 Participants
Notifications
Due Date
The due date is invalid or out of range. Please use the format 'yyyy-mm-dd'.

No due date set.

Dependencies

No dependencies set.

Reference: your-land/bugtracker#2189
No description provided.